We think the answer is "OATH" which means:
- noun
- • Profane or obscene expression usually of surprise or anger
- • A commitment to tell the truth (especially in a court of law); to lie under oath is to become subject to prosecution for perjury
- • A solemn promise, usually invoking a divine witness, regarding your future acts or behavior verb
- • To pledge.
An example sentence would be:
- • "He took an oath to protect and serve his country."
- • "The witness was asked to swear on the bible and take an oath."
